find the mean of 31.6, 34.5, 29.8, 12,1

Answer:

27

Step-by-step explanation:

To figure out the mean of a group of numbers, one must add the numbers together and divide by the number of terms.

31.6 + 34.5 + 29.8 + 12.1 = 108

There are four terms in the group of numbers.

108 / 4 = 27

Therefore, the mean is 27.
